Building Code Review Committee Minutes 1/10/2007

Minutes – Building Code Review Committee
5:00 PM, January 10, 2007



Meeting was called to order at 5:10 PM.

In attendance were Denny Blumberg, Susan Holden, Rich Gorazd and Dave Holtgrave and City Staff member Jeff Stehman, Jerry Koerkenmeier and Dan Bowman.  Also in attendance was Aldermen Drolet.

Motion was made to approve minutes from the March 14, 2006 meeting by Holden, seconded by Blumberg.  Motion passed.

The next item was hearing of an appeal by Lou Girdler, an architect from Paradigm Architects, representing First Bank who is building a new facility at W. Highway 50 and Greenmount Road.  Stehman stated that they wish to appeal the provision of the City of O’Fallon Electrical Code that prohibits the use of aluminum wiring.  Due to the fact that they want to mount the CT cabinet well away from the building, it will add a significant amount of copper feeders to comply with the city requirement.

Stehman stated that the only aluminum wiring allowed is what Ameren runs from the pole or transformer into the service panel (primary feeders).  Girdler and other attendees representing his firm stated that the NEC allows such a run in aluminum and the problems of years ago with aluminum wiring have been corrected and larger cities such as Chicago and St. Louis have removed the ban of aluminum wiring.  They presented additional written documentation and testimony.

Stehman stated that city staff still does not want to see aluminum wiring introduced into the building and branch circuits, but realizes that we currently allow it run into the service panel.

After much discussion between all sides of this issue and the committee, all parties agreed that putting a junction box outside the building and running services feeders to that box in aluminum and then copper into the service panel would be acceptable to the city and the applicant.  Based on that agreement and the fact that it met the intent of the city electrical code, and decision on the appeal by the committee was not required.

Motion to adjourn by Gorazd, seconded by Holden at approximately 6:15 PM.
